The Lead Director of Assessments will serve as the enterprise owner of assessments, responsible for designing and leading a unified, enterprise-wide assessments strategy that spans selection, development, skills capability, and executive-level assessments. This leader will bring together previously decentralized assessment practices into a cohesive, scalable, and strategic approach that supports talent decisions and development across the colleague lifecycle. The position involves stakeholder engagement, discovery, vendor management, resource planning, and strong partnership with DDAT HR Technology and HR Analytics to drive innovation, analytics integration, and measurable business impact. The Lead Director will ensure assessment strategy aligns with CVS Health’s transformation goals and culture priorities, embedding assessment insights into workforce planning, leadership development, and succession.

Key Responsibilities

  • Design and implement an end-to-end assessments strategy that supports selection, development, skills capability, and executive talent planning.
  • Serve as the enterprise owner of assessments, driving innovation, consistency, and measurable impact across the colleague lifecycle.
  • Lead discovery efforts to understand current-state practices, gaps, and opportunities across business units and talent functions.
  • Partner with Talent Acquisition, Talent Development, Executive Talent Management, DDAT HR Technology, HR Analytics, HRBPs and other stakeholders to integrate assessments into key talent processes and digital platforms.
  • Manage vendor relationships and develop a cohesive vendor strategy that supports enterprise needs and drives innovation in assessment practices.
  • Oversee a team of assessment professionals.
  • Establish governance, standards, and continuity across assessment tools and practices, continuously benchmarking against external best practices.
  • Allocate resources effectively to balance high-volume selection needs with strategic development and executive assessment priorities.
  • Collaborate with senior leaders to ensure assessments inform succession planning, development actions, and talent decisions.
  • Integrate assessment insights into talent reviews, workforce planning, and leadership development programs.
  • Define and track assessment KPIs and outcomes, leveraging data and analytics to demonstrate business impact and inform continuous improvement.
  • Champion a culture of data-driven, equitable talent decisions by embedding assessments into DEIB and culture strategies.
  • Identify opportunities for efficiency and scalability, informed by benchmarking.

Required Qualifications

  • 10+ years of experience in talent assessment, organizational development, or related fields.
  • Proven success designing and implementing enterprise-wide assessment strategies across selection and development.
  • Experience managing assessment programs for high-volume roles as well as executive-level talent.
  • Strong stakeholder management and collaboration skills across HR, business units, and shared services.
  • Experience with vendor selection, management, and integration.
  • Ability to synthesize data, feedback, and insights into actionable strategy.
  • Skilled in resource planning and team leadership in complex, matrixed environments.
